A straight conductor of length 0.4 m is moved with a speed of 7 ms⁻¹perpendicular to a magnetic field of intensity 0.9 Wbm⁻². The induced emf across the conductor is

Options

(a) 5.04 V
(b) 1.26 V
(c) 2.52 V
(d) 25.2 V

Correct Answer:

2.52 V
